General Standards Inc. makes a PMC module with 64 parallel 16-bit digitizers. It can be configured to 64 single-ended, 32 differential (digital differences!) channels. Very compact and not extremely expensive (3.5k); EPICS drivers available.

EPICS colleagues:
The LLNL group that is supplying the diagnostics to commission the LCLS needs a digitizer for an energy measurement instrument (calorimeter) with the following characteristics:
- 100 channels sampled simultaneously - each channel takes 100 samples at 10us per sample (1 ms total time) - differential inputs - 12 bits minimum; 14 or even 16 bits preferred - sampling repeats at 120 Hz major cycle with trigger
A VME or VXI format is ideal.
